1. Alibaba reported mixed second quarter results with a slight revenue increase but a decline in operating income and diluted earnings per share. 2. The company's e-commerce segment, Taobao and Tmall Group, remains its core business but faces challenges in a struggling Chinese retail market. 3. Alibaba's cloud and international expansion segments show potential for growth, and the stock is considered deeply undervalued.
